用 XmlWriter 编写 XML
更新:November 2007
XmlWriter 类是一个抽象基类,提供只进、只写、非缓存的方式来生成 XML 流。 可以用于构建符合 W3C 可扩展标记语言 (XML) 1.0(第二版)(www.w3.org/TR/2000/REC-xml-20001006.html) 建议和 XML 中的命名空间建议 (www.w3.org/TR/REC-xml-names/) 的 XML 文档。
XmlWriter 使您可以:
检查字符是不是合法的 XML 字符,元素和属性的名称是不是有效的 XML 名称。
检查 XML 文档的格式是否正确。
将二进制字节编码为 base64 或 binhex,并写出生成的文本。
使用公共语言运行库类型传递值,而不是使用字符串。 这样可以避免必须手动执行值的转换。
将多个文档写入一个输出流。
写出有效的名称、限定名和名称标记。
本节内容
XmlWriter 类中的新功能
描述对 XmlWriter 类的更改。使用 XmlWriter
描述如何创建 XmlWriter 对象,如何编写类型化数据,以及其他常见的 XmlWriter 用法。
相关章节
- XML 文档和数据
提供对在 .NET Framework 中使用 XML 文档和数据的全面和集成的类集的概述。